The Wee Seal Summary

The Wee Seal by Janis Mackay

Jamie has been watching the wee white seal that lives on the beach. At night the wee seal cuddles up to its mother. In the morning she goes out to sea and leaves it alone like a strange white stone on the sand.

One day tourists come and crowd the wee seal but Jamie knows just what to do to protect it until its mother comes back...

Janis Mackay's lyrical prose tells the story of the tender relationship between a wild baby seal and the young boy who watches over it, while Gabby Grant's soft illustrations brilliantly evoke the landscape of the Orkney Islands.

About Janis Mackay

Janis Mackay was born and grew up in Edinburgh, but moved to London to study journalism. She has an MA in Creative Writing and has held writer-in-residence posts in both Caithness and Sutherland. She currently lives in Edinburgh, where she teaches creative writing and works as a writer and storyteller. She is the author of the Magnus Fin series, and The Accidental Time Traveller, for older children. Gabby Grant studied illustration at Westminster University, London. She combines illustration with graphic design and prop-making for TV and film, and has worked on programmes ranging from Newsnight to Harry Hill's TV Burp. She is the illustrator of three other Picture Kelpies, The Big Bottom Hunt by Lari Don, and Lewis Clowns Around and Harris the Hero, by Lynne Rickards.
